Just In: Fire Kills Illegal Petrol Marketer, Wife In Jos

A couple was killed on Thursday, March 3, 2022, when a fire erupted from the kitchen where Gideon Pam, the husband hoarded petrol at their residence in the Zawan community of Jos South Local Government Area of Plateau.

Miss Shantel Alphonsus, an eyewitness, and the neighbor told the journalists that “Pam runs an illegal petrol business at Zawan Junction.”

Miss Alphonsus said,

“In the morning, he was called upon to get more supply from a fuel station, so he rushed back home to get some empty gallons to hoard scarce petrol.

“In a bid to empty some of the gallons that had fuel in them, suddenly there was a fire outburst in the kitchen where the gallons were kept and Pam was trapped.

“His wife, Mercy, who had gone out earlier returned and saw smoke emitting from the house.

“She went into the house to save her husband, but was equally trapped in the inferno,’’.

She added that the couple left a four-month-old baby who had earlier been taken away by Pam’s mother at an earlier visit.

Director, Plateau Fire Service Mr. Caleb Polit, confirmed the incident and expressed regret that the couple was burnt beyond recognition and the house razed before firemen could reach the scene.
